Understanding Driver's Licenses in Finland
Finland needs all vehicle drivers to hold a valid chauffeur's license that refers the automobile type they plan to drive. The Finnish chauffeur's license system is controlled by the Finnish Transport and Communications Agency (Traficom), making sure that just qualified people can operate lorries within the country.
Chauffeur's License Categories
In Finland, licenses are categorized based on vehicle types. Below is a concise table of the different license categories:

Purchasing a Finnish motorist's license online raises several ethical and legal concerns. The procedure in Finland includes extensive screening (both theoretical and practical) to guarantee that all drivers are proficient behind the wheel. Hence, buying a motorist's license without undergoing the needed evaluations is thought about prohibited and is greatly punished.
Legitimate Online Processes:
While direct online purchases are illegal, there are legitimate online methods for acquiring a chauffeur's license in Finland:
Application Process: Individuals can apply for a motorist's license online through Traficom's main website. Online Theory Courses: Prospective motorists can take theory lessons from certified online platforms to get ready for the driving tests.Booking Tests: Online centers enable users to schedule their useful and theoretical evaluations perfectly.Steps to Apply for a Driver's License Online

Q2: How long does it take to get my driver's license after passing the tests?
Normally, you can anticipate your driver's license to get here through mail within 1-2 weeks after passing the required tests.
Q3: What should I do if I lose my motorist's license?
If you lose your driver's license, you should report it to the cops and request a replacement through the Traficom website.
